Installing Ubuntu Touch onto a supported mobile device is fairly easy, especially if you have already configured your machine for Android app development. To learn more about Linux and Unix in general, you should install Ubuntu. These instructions assume some familiarity with the OSX command line (Terminal app) and basic Unix-like concepts. These instructions were developed and tested on a relatively clean OSX 10.9 (Mavericks) installation. Many mobile app developers choose OSX as their primary development environment.
